Reading response about eraser tattoo

English
1 answer:
Ymorist [56]2 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Eraser tattoo is a sweet story about teenagers having to say goodbye to their first love because one must move away. Through a series of flashbacks along with actions happening in the present time that one of them always has been and always would have been more in love with the other.

Read the passage from "Song of Myself."
gavmur [86]
I would say the answer is "harbor". This word is usually used as a noun; but in this case, it is a verb that means to provide shelter to someone or something, to keep someone safe, but also to have something in mind and think about it. This word is purposefully chosen and fits into Whitman's well-intended, philanthropic and inclusive worldview.
